Hey guys!
Yesterday I went to the my little practice shed and did a run through of the Mahavishnu Orchestra classic "The Dance of Maya" from The Inner Mounting Flame.
Interesting playing this quirky "bluesy" groove in 10/8, I´d say. It wasn´t the easiest thing to keep it all on track and not loose oneself in the groove (as I sure did a couple of times), but there you go.
I love the section right before the end where the melodic comes in super-imposed over the other which to me sounds like two planets are on collision course, or something like that! hehe
What an intense piece of musical masterpiece this is! I absolutely love the Mahavishnu Orchestra and Billy Cobham is such a huge influence to me.
